William E. McEwen Candidate

Born: August 10, 1874
Duluth, Minnesota
Saint Louis County
United States
Resided: Duluth, Minnesota
Saint Louis County
Death: February 15, 1933
Gender: Man
Occupation: Publisher, The Labor World
Political Party: Democrat-People's; Farmer-Labor
Notes: McEwen was a former plumber. He was secretary and treasurer of the Minnesota Federation of Labor from 1896 to 1908. In 1908, Governor John A. Johnson appointed him State Oil Inspector and then State Labor Commissioner in 1909. He ran for Mayor of Duluth in 1913 and narrowly lost.
